Sunny GTS 2 Wholesale price at the yards here in the Philippines:
Prices dependent on Dollar to Peso exchange
Sunny GTS2 4-lamp set - $120
Sunny GTS2 Sideskirts pair - $100 now very rare
Sunny GTS2 rear bumper - $40 or less
No sheet. Side skirts "Very Rare" and they don't fit a B13 w/o some cutting.

Shipping from other Asian Countries is way lower compared to the Philippines meng, Philpost which is cheaper than DHL, UPS, FEDEX does not have their own fleet and has to farm out to other carriers which adds to the cost.
for DHL, UPS, FEDEX, there are not a lot of packages going out of the country so the costomer end in the philippines shoulders the cost (from what a buddy at FEDEX tell me cmmiw.
got a quote from UPS to ship a set of headlamps and it was close to $200.
The only way we can ship with minimal cost would be Sea Freight.
